Football Preview: South Walton Seahawks vs. Wakulla War Eagles
The South Walton Seahawks are on the road again on Friday to play the Wakulla War Eagles at 7:00 p.m. Wakulla took a loss in their last game and will be looking to turn the tables on South Walton, who comes in off a win.
South Walton's defense heads into the contest hoping to repeat the dominance they displayed on Friday. They took their matchup on the road with ease, bagging a 48-0 win over Freeport. The Seahawks' offense stepped up their game for this one, as that was the most points they've scored all season.
Jd Brown went supernova for South Walton, rushing for 84 yards and three touchdowns on only five carries, while also throwing for 215 yards and two touchdowns. The dominant performance gave Brown a new career-high in rushing yards. Grant Gilmore did his part to keep the secondary busy, picking up 92 receiving yards.
Perhaps unsurprisingly given the score, South Walton was unstoppable on the ground and finished the game with 209 rushing yards. That's the most rushing yards they've managed all season.
Meanwhile, Wakulla entered their match against Godby on Friday without any home losses, but there's a first time for everything. Wakulla lost 27-7 to Godby. The game marked the War Eagles' lowest-scoring contest so far this season.
South Walton moved to 2-5 with that victory, which also ended their three-game losing streak. As for Wakulla, their loss dropped their record down to 4-2.
